BENGALURU: Parents looking to getting seats for their wards under Right to Education (RTE) quota for 2018-19 academic year don’t have to worry. The State Election Commission has cleared the request submitted by state Department of Public Instruction (DPI) to allot seats through online lottery.

Officials from the department have confirmed that they have received permission on Wednesday and the lottery will be conducted in the next two days.

As per the schedule, online lottery for allotment of seats under RTE  quota should be conducted on April 20. But the department did not notify the date as there was no response from the State Election Commission. “As we have received the communication now, the notification will be issued,” said P C Jaffer, commissioner of DPI.

Ahmedabad, May 2 (PTI): Gujarat Titans inched closer to sealing a playoff spot with a 38-run win over Sunrisers Hyderabad in their IPL match here on Friday.

Invited to bat, skipper Shubman Gill scored a 38-ball 76 before Jos Buttler slammed 64 off 37 deliveries for the Titans.

In reply, Abhishek Sharma (74) gave SRH a solid start but GT bowlers stopped the visitors at 186 for 6.

Brief Scores:

Gujarat Titans 224 for 6 in 20 overs (Shubman Gill 76, Jos Buttler 64; Jaydev Unadkat 3/35).

Sunrisers Hyderbad 186 for 6 in 20 overs (Abhishek Sharma 74; Mohammed Siraj 2/33, Prasidh Krishna 2/19).
